Safety history
- September 28, 1971AccidentHull loss
Shortly after takeoff from Sena Madureira Airport, while climbing, the pilot declared an emergency and elected to return following an engine failure. He completed a circuit at low altitude and while completing a turn to the right, the airplane struck trees and crashed in flames in a dense wooded area located few km from the airport. The aircraft was totally destroyed and all 32 occupants were killed. Probable cause (official findings): Engine failure during initial climb.
